Cisco Webex Calling
Cisco Webex Calling represents the evolution of enterprise telephony, merging decades of Cisco's networking expertise with modern cloud communications. As a VoIP solution born from one of the world's most trusted infrastructure companies, it delivers phone system capabilities that seamlessly integrate with the broader Webex collaboration ecosystem, making it particularly compelling for organizations already invested in Cisco infrastructure or those prioritizing security and reliability above all else.

Mitel
Mitel stands out in the crowded VoIP landscape as a battle-tested enterprise solution that's been helping multi-location businesses communicate effectively for decades. While newer providers chase flashy features, Mitel has focused on building a comprehensive platform that genuinely understands the complexity of modern organizational communication.
Feature Comparison
| Feature | Cisco Webex Calling | Mitel |
|---|---|---|
| Starting Price | $25/user/mo | $20.99/user/mo |
| Free Trial | 30 days | No |
| Contract Length | 1 year | month to_month |
| Customer Rating | 4.1 / 5.0 | 3.9 / 5.0 |
| Setup Fee | $0 | $0 |
Pros & Cons
Cisco Webex Calling
Advantages
- Enterprise-grade reliability
- Strong video conferencing
- Excellent security features
- Good for large organizations
Disadvantages
- Complex licensing structure
- Can be expensive
- Setup requires expertise
- Overkill for small businesses
Mitel
Advantages
- Comprehensive enterprise features
- Good for multi-location businesses
- Flexible deployment options
- Strong in healthcare and hospitality
Disadvantages
- Can be expensive
- Setup requires technical expertise
- User interface feels dated
- Customer support varies by partner
